Chemical engineers play crucial roles in large-scale industrial production. Through Gannon's cooperative chemical engineering program, your expanding STEM expertise will equip you to plan equipment configurations, identify cost-saving production improvements, and emphasize health, safety, and environmental factors as you train for high-demand professions.
Acquire practical experience through essential chemistry and engineering coursework such as:
Differential Equations: Examine ordinary differential equations and their scientific and engineering applications.
Organic Chemistry Laboratory: Investigate organic molecular reactions and learn spectroscopic identification techniques.
Physical Chemistry: Explore atomic and molecular behavior patterns along with chemical reaction mechanisms.
